Coupang Inc posted operating profit of 11.5 billion won ($8 million) in the fourth quarter of last year. That was down 97 percent from a year earlier. The company said the fallout from a large-scale personal data leak appeared to have a negative effect on fourth-quarter revenue growth, active customers, Wow membership and profitability. For the full year, revenue of 49.12 trillion won and net profit of 303.0 billion won were the largest on record.

Coupang said on Feb. 27 that fourth-quarter operating profit fell 97 percent from 435.3 billion won ($312 million) a year earlier to 11.5 billion won ($8 million). It posted a net loss of 37.7 billion won ($26 million), swinging from a net profit of 182.7 billion won ($131 million) a year earlier.

Revenue for the period rose 11 percent from 11.11 trillion won a year earlier to 12.81 trillion won ($8.84 billion). On a constant-currency basis, excluding foreign exchange fluctuations, it rose 14 percent. Fourth-quarter revenue fell 5 percent from 12.85 trillion won in the previous third quarter.

The figures are converted based on an average quarterly won-dollar exchange rate of 1,449.96 won in the fourth quarter of last year.

By business segment, fourth-quarter revenue from product commerce rose 8 percent from a year earlier to 10.74 trillion won ($7.41 billion). On a constant-currency basis, it rose 12 percent. The product commerce segment includes Rocket Delivery, Rocket Fresh, Rocket Growth and the marketplace.

Fourth-quarter revenue from growth businesses, including Farfetch, Taiwan, Coupang Eats and Coupang Play, rose 32 percent from a year earlier. The growth businesses posted an adjusted EBITDA loss of 434.9 billion won ($300 million) in the fourth quarter, widening from 164.6 billion won a year earlier.

Coupang's full-year operating profit last year rose 8 percent from a year earlier to 679.0 billion won ($473 million). The annual operating margin fell to 1.38 percent from 1.46 percent a year earlier. Coupang Inc's annual operating profit was 617.0 billion won in 2023 and 602.3 billion won in 2024. The annual operating margin was 1.38 percent, down from 1.46 percent a year earlier.

Annual revenue was 49.12 trillion won ($34.53 billion), falling short of 50 trillion won but growing 14 percent from 41.29 trillion won ($30.27 billion) a year earlier. Net profit was 303.0 billion won ($214 million), more than tripling from 94.0 billion won ($66 million) a year earlier.

By segment, annual revenue from product commerce rose 11 percent from a year earlier to 42.09 trillion won. Revenue rose 38 percent from a year earlier on a constant-currency basis. Revenue from growth businesses, including Taiwan and Farfetch, rose 38 percent from a year earlier to 7.03 trillion won ($4.94 billion). On a constant-currency basis, it rose 40 percent.

On customer metrics, active customers in the product commerce segment in the fourth quarter rose 8 percent from a year earlier to 24.60 million. Active customers are customers who bought a product at least once in a quarter. The figure fell by 100,000 from 24.70 million in the previous third quarter.

Coupang said, "We estimate the personal data incident had a negative effect on fourth-quarter revenue growth, active customers, Wow membership and profitability from December last year." It said, "But its impact on recent growth has since stabilised and we are seeing a recovery from the first quarter of this year."
